Hygienic safety of outdoor playgrounds with sandbox

Playgrounds represent danger of a direct input of hazardous substances into children`s organism, that`s why they require a special attention. The diploma thesis deals with hygienic safety of outside playgrounds with sandpits in scope of valid legislation and medical risks, which might be caused by contamination. The aim of the thesis is to assess the level of microbiological, parasitical and chemical contamination and hygienic safety of sand in outside playgrounds with sandpits in Hradec Kralove. To check the contamination, samples of sand were taken in outside playgrounds with sandpits destined for children in Hradec Kralove. Safety parameters of taken samples were rated according to notice No. 238/2011 Coll., about setting of hygienic requirements for swimming pools, saunas and hygienic limits for sand in sandpits of outside playgrounds. The evaluation of samples was concentrated on microbiological, chemical and parasitical contamination of sandpits, which was analyzed by Medical Institute based in Usti nad Labem. The influence of position of playground within the town (city center vs. outskirts), time of collecting samples and age of each sandpit were judged. The sandpits in Hradec Kralove in the years 2014 and 2015 were microbially contaminated over established limits only in one case. Parasitical or chemical contamination was not found in any case. Next conclusion is that sandpits at end of season are contaminated by microorganisms about 18 % more often than at start of season and at the same time that sandpits in city center are contaminated about 14 % more frequently than in outskirts. New sandpits are often contaminated by thermotolerant coliform bacteria than old sandpits. From the point of view of chemical contamination, sandpits in city center are more contaminated by chemicals, however statistical difference is not significant. The discovered values of sand at start and end of season were misrepresented by addition of sand in sandpits in the course of main season. Sandpits in Hradec Kralove had a high level of hygienic safety, which is determined in law No 258/2000 Coll., about protection of public health.

Small-scale biogas technology in Southeast Asian countries: current state, bottlenecks and perspectives

Biogas produced via the anaerobic digestion (AD) of organic waste materials is considered as an important technology in improving the environment because it solves waste management problems and simultaneously produces biogas as a main product and digestate as a by-product, which can also be used as a fertilizer. Within the rising expectations for the substitution of fossil energy with renewable energy as one of the solutions to cope with climate change, the environmental aspects of small-scale biogas plants, as widely used method for energy creation, should be evaluated in a holistic and systematic way. The use of small-scale biogas plants is mostly common for energy creation from waste in Southeast Asia. This source of energy is mainly lauded for its low costs, clean production and high fertilization effects of digested matter for crops. There are number of advantages of small-scale biogas production on farms, including also savings on firewood or fossil fuels and reduction in odour and greenhouse gas emissions from using other fuels. However, biogas plants are often poorly managed and there is lack of proper distribution systems for biogas. That results in methane being release inadvertently through leaks in digesters and tubing, and intentionally when production exceeds demand. As methane has a global warming potential 25 times higher than that of carbon dioxide, environmental advantages of small-scale biogas plants might be compromised. Biological methods of monitoring insecticides resistant populations of selected oilseed rape pests

The literary part of the thesis describes biology, economic importance and methods of chemical protection against pollen beetle, cabbage seed weevil and cabbage stem flea beetle. The resistance of these pests against zoocides in the Czech republic and in some parts of neighbour European countries is decribed and principles of antiresistance strategies are outlined. Each group of insecticides is describd and their active components are rated in the practical part of the thesis. Findings about pest resistance are summarized - resistance types and mechanisms in particular. Then monitoring of resistent populations of plant pests are described. New findings concerning the resistance of three oilseed rape pests were acquired using biological methods. For cabage seed weevil six areas were evaluated, for pollen beetle seven and for cabbage stem flea beetle two areas were evaluated. All the evaluated areas are in the Czech republic. The adult-vial test number 11, nr. 25, nr. 27 accordinng to IRAC methodology and topical aplication test were used to rate the resistance. The efficiency of five pyrethroids (deltamethrin, lambda-cyhalothrin, esfenvalerate, etofenprox, tau-fluvalinate, cypermethrin), one organophosphate (chlorpyrifos - cabbage stem flea beetle only) and one oxadiazin (indoxacarb) in different concentrations were rated. The mortality of the pests was rated 24 hours after active component functioning for pollen beetle and cabbage seed weevil and after 48 hours for cabage stem flea beetle. Then lethal concentration LC50 and LC95 values were assessed. For ppollen beetle, the resistance against pyrethroids was confirmed with the exception, the effect of neonicotinoids was variable, acetamiprid and thiacloprid showed reduced efficiency in populations of some areas. Assessed populations of cabbage seed weevil and cabbage stem flea beetle were very sensitive to pyrethroids, but neonicotinoids showed insufficient efficiency. The indoxacarb sensitivity of pollen beetle and cabbage stem flea beetle was high.

Trichurids in ruminants from Czech Republic.

The goal of this paper was to determine rate of presence of whipworms of genus Trichuris in bodies of selected ruminants (sheep, roe deer) in certain areas and to morphologically state different species of whipworms using molecular revision and professional literature on samples found during helmitological dissections of selected ruminants. Two hypotheses were stated: H1: species that are found in highest volume in case of roe deer and sheep are whipworms Trichuris discolor and Trichuris ovis H2: these whipworms can not be positively distinguished when using morphometrical methods. Material needed for the study, i.e. the intestines of examined ruminants, was recovered in different areas of Czech Republic. Later were the intestines dissected in a laboratory using standardized procedure and hereby collected samples were analysed. Based on selected methods it was determined that in roe deer the rate of occurence of Trichuris discolor is much higher compared to that of Trichuris ovis. With sheep the difference between rates of presence is smaller. These results confirm the first hypothesis by showing high rate of presence of whipworms in these hosts. Collected females of genus Trichurids were morphometrically differentiated by their sex and in 4 morphotypes. Following this differentiation, the most present were the females of morphotype M2, those with a vulval opening without an everted vagina. The second hypothesis was also confirmed. Multihosting species Trichuris discolor and Trichuris ovis are prevalent in the bodies of roe deer and sheep. Thus we can say the roe deer are a potential source of whipworm contamination to sheep breeding. It can not be excluded that sheep are infected by roe deer and vice versa. Molecular determination is a necessary tool for correct assessment of whipworm species, considering the fact that morphological methods may lead to incorrect results.

Traditional Methods of Fish Preservation in Southeast Asia

Traditional methods of fish preservation are still often used in developing countries, which produce significant amount of fresh fish. The most frequently used methods of processing fish in Cambodia are drying, salting, fermentation, smoking and marinating. Sun drying as one of the most common methods of fish processing in Cambodia has some disadvantages, which increase spoilage of final product. Salting contributes to increase efficiency of drying process. Salt creates highly salty environment, which the most bacteria, fungi and other potentially pathogenic organism cannot survive in. The aim of this Bachelors thesis was to carry out research focused on drying method in combination with salting. For five selected spices of freshwater fish: Claris batrachus, Channa micropeltes, Oreochromis niloticus, Pangasius hypophthalmus and Monopterus albus were determined dry matter content, fat content and salting effect on the amount of salt. Samples, before drying in direct solar dryer with natural convection and electric oven, were salted for 2, 4 and 12 hours. Results of measuring of dry matter content are within the interval 16.67 to 21.74 g on 100 g of fresh muscle, the lowest values were measured at C. batrachus and the highest at O. niloticus. Measuring of fat content showed difference in the interval 2.29 - 30.08 %, the lowest value at M. albus and highest at P. hypophthalmus. From the measurements of amount of salt were found influence of the salting time on the total amount of salt. Values increased with the higher time of salting. An important prerequisite for achieving high-quality dried products is characteristic properties for individual fish species to achieve maximum yield.

Changes to the contents of proline and relative electrolyte leakage of the selected genotypes of poppies depending on the influence by low temperature

The object of this thesis is to study the effect of low temperatures, proline content and relative elektrolyte leakage in a selected range of varieties of opium poppy. Experiment included 18 poppy varieties with different contents of morphine. Poppy seeds for this experiment were provided by GB Oseva Pro s r.o., o.z.VÚO Opava a Český mák s.r.o. Poppy seeds were sown in containers of a size of 7,5x7,5 cm. Used cultivation medium is mixture of garden substrate A with quartz sand in a ratio of 2: 1. Plants were grown under controlled conditions in grow chamber Conviron E8. Before starting the experiment, the temperature was at 10 ° C during day and 5 ° C over night. Light cycle was 13 hours light and 11 hours darkness. The maximum value of irradiance was 800 micromol. The experiment was initiated in phase of rosette develoment. At this developmental stage were the plants exposed to frost temperatures (-5 ° C) over night and chill temperatures (10 ° C) duringthe day. After a week the plants were regenerated for 1 week at 5 ° C over night and 10 C during the day. All tested plants were in two day intervals measured of proline concentration after exposure to low temperature stress. At the same intervals as proline, were measured the values of relative elektrolyte leakage (Rel%).The obtained results show that the influence of low temperature causes increase of proline level. Control winter-crop variety Zeno exhibited the high kontent of proline (693.33 microg.g -1) in comparison with the spring poppy varieties. After regeneration were afected varieties Lazur, Opal, Buddha, Korneuburger Weisser, Aplaus, Major, Sokol, Zeno reduced the content of proline under the influence of higher temperatures. On the other hand the varieties Ofeus, Tatranský, Opex, Orbis, Maraton, Florián, Marianne and Albin were reversed with an increase of proline level. Proline concentration levels were constant and unchanged in case of varietes Postomi and Akvarel. Values of relative elektrolyte leakage were increased proportionately with length of exposure to low temperatures on the tested plants. The lowest value of membrane damage was after exposure to low temperatures observed in case of variety Zeno (23.53%). In the case of spring varieties was lowest membráně damage estimated in a variety Korneuburger Weisser (44.88%), while the highest was in the variety Orfeus (53.15%). It demonstrated the different responses of individual poppy varieties at low temperature. Most sensitive to low temperature were varieties Orfeus, Postomi, Akvarel, Orbis, Sokol and Marianne. As less sensitive to stress caused by low temperature seems to be spring varieties Opex, Buddha, Korneuburger Weisser, Albín.
